If f(x) = -x^3 + 2x^2 - 3, find f(2).

A) -19
B) -3
C) -1
D) 5

Answer:

B

Step-by-step explanation:

To evaluate f(2) substitute x = 2 into f(x), that is

f(2) = - (2)³ + 2(2)² - 3 = - 8 +2(4) - 3 = - 8 + 8 - 3 = - 3
